Overcoming Coastal Installation Challenges
While the seaside offers advantages, it's not all smooth sailing. Here's how to tackle common issues:
Salt Corrosion Protection
Salt spray can reduce panel lifespan by 30% if unprotected. Top solutions include:
- Anti-corrosive aluminum frames
- Regular freshwater rinsing systems
- PID-resistant solar modules
"Our coastal installations use marine-grade materials similar to those in shipbuilding." – EK SOLAR Engineering Team
Wind Load Management
Coastal winds averaging 15-20 mph require specialized mounting systems. The latest tilt-and-lock racks can withstand 140 mph gusts – that's hurricane territory!

Maintenance Tips for Coastal Systems
Keep your seaside PV system running smoothly with these pro tips:
- Inspect connectors quarterly for salt buildup
- Use robotic cleaners to prevent abrasive sand damage
- Monitor performance daily through IoT platforms

FAQ: Coastal Solar Installation
How often should panels be cleaned?
Every 6-8 weeks in high-salt environments. Consider automated cleaning systems for hard-to-reach areas.
Can panels withstand tropical storms?
Yes, when properly installed. Look for IEC 61701 certification for salt mist resistance and IEC 61215 for mechanical load.
